How product claims are checked

Testing Methodology

We separate deterministic software checks from real-device listening tests. A passing calculation test does not prove that every microphone, room, browser, or instrument will produce the same result.

Reference pitch and note calculations

Target frequencies use 12-tone equal temperament with A4 set to 440 Hz by default. The implementation converts MIDI note values to frequency and measures the ratio between detected and target frequencies in cents.

Automated checks verify representative target frequencies and preserve a full 1,200-cent difference between notes one octave apart. They also check that displayed tuning definitions and explanatory copy stay aligned with the application data.

What the automated checks cover

  • Reference-frequency calculations and cents deviation.
  • Octave-sensitive note definitions for supported instrument tunings.
  • Consistency between the tuning catalog and localized tuning copy.
  • Route availability and links between related guides and tools.
  • Production compilation, static generation, canonical URLs, and sitemap policy.

Browser and microphone behavior

The browser requests microphone access and processes the live signal locally through the Web Audio API and the pitch-detection engine. Input hardware, automatic gain control, room noise, harmonics, attack transients, and browser processing can all affect the detected pitch.

A practical check uses one isolated string or stable reference tone at a time, waits for the reading to settle, and compares the displayed note, frequency, and cents deviation with the expected target. Device and browser details must be recorded before an article receives a “Last tested” date.

Article-level evidence

A source link means the cited reference was used to check a core claim. A “Last tested” date has a narrower meaning: someone followed a recorded procedure using the relevant product or instrument. We do not infer hands-on testing from research alone.

Known limits

  • The tuner is not represented as a laboratory-certified measurement device.
  • String-gauge suggestions are starting points, not universal prescriptions.
  • Instrument setup outcomes vary with scale length, construction, hardware, action, and playing style.
  • Work that requires nut filing, truss-rod adjustment, or structural diagnosis may need a qualified technician.
